Leopard cat vs Little Clusterfly
Prionailurus bengalensis compared with Pollenia griseotomentosa
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Leopard cat | Little Clusterfly |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Carnivora (Carnivorans) | Diptera (Diptera) |
| Family | Felidae (Cats) | Polleniidae |
| Genus | Prionailurus | Pollenia |
| Species | Prionailurus bengalensis | Pollenia griseotomentosa |
Evolutionary Relationship
Leopard cat and Little Clusterfly share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
